This discussion features Thomas Peterffy, founder of Interactive Brokers, sharing insights on consumer trends and the role of election forecasting in trading. Mohamed El-Erian provides an optimistic view on a potential economic soft landing. CEOs Pedro Franceschi of Brex and Ariel Cohen of Navan reveal their new partnership aimed at streamlining business travel expenses. The talk also touches on the influence of AI in investments and the current market volatility, highlighting strategies for navigating these changes.

Semiconductor Underperformance
- Semiconductors underperforming the market is a concern, despite AI strength.
- This could signal broader economic weakness beyond the AI sector.
Strong Election Year Start
- The market's strong start to the election year suggests an ongoing bull market.
- Investors should expect some downside but maintain a focus on equities.
Sustained High Trading Volume
- High trading volume persists, driven by AI enthusiasm and excess money in the economy.
- Thomas Peterffy notes this trend while questioning its rationale.
